Conditions

Post-stroke Dysphagia?

Interventions

Control group:A model of pharyngeal stimulation training using a large cotton swab dipped in ice water based on conventional drug treatment.
Experimental group:Combined conventional drug therapy with medium-frequency computerized electrical stimulation based on pulsed current

Inclusion criteria

Inclusion criteria: 1. All patients have varying degrees of swallowing disorders, specifically manifested as food easily getting stuck, difficulty chewing, and coughing when drinking water; 2. All patients are conscious, with normal vital signs and no pulmonary infections; 3. Patients have no mental or intellectual disabilities and can understand instructions given by medical personnel; 4. Patients and their families agree to participate in this study.

Exclusion criteria

Exclusion criteria: 1. The patient's organ functions have all shown varying degrees of failure; 2. The patient's condition is relatively serious, or the family does not agree to participate in this study; 3. Patients who stop mid-frequency EEG stimulation treatment or are unable to tolerate the treatment.
